What state is Everglades National Park in? Nestled in the southeastern part of Florida, Everglades National Park is a unique and breathtaking destination that showcases the beauty and diversity of the Florida Everglades. This 1.5 million-acre park is a haven for wildlife enthusiasts, nature lovers, and outdoor adventurers alike. Everglades National Park is one of the most significant wetland ecosystems in the world, and it is home to a wide variety of plants, animals, and habitats. The park is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and a designated International Biosphere Reserve, highlighting its importance in preserving the natural environment. The park’s unique landscape is characterized by sawgrass marshes, mangrove forests, and Everglades cypress swamps, creating a habitat for over 350 bird species, 300 species of fish, and numerous other animals.

The park’s history dates back to the early 20th century when the Everglades were threatened by development and agricultural activities. In response, conservationists and local communities fought to protect this unique ecosystem. In 1947, President Harry S. Truman designated the area as a national park, ensuring its preservation for future generations.

One of the most famous inhabitants of the Everglades is the American alligator, which can be found in abundance throughout the park. Other notable wildlife includes the Florida panther, manatees, and a variety of wading birds such as the great blue heron and the roseate spoonbill. The park’s diverse ecosystem is a testament to the importance of preserving wetland habitats and the delicate balance of nature.

Visitors to Everglades National Park can enjoy a variety of activities, from hiking and biking to canoeing and kayaking. The park offers numerous trails and boardwalks that allow visitors to explore the unique habitats and observe wildlife up close. For those interested in a more immersive experience, guided boat tours are available, providing an opportunity to navigate the park’s waterways and witness the Everglades from a different perspective.
